12,848,040 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
12848040 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 12848040:
23 × 32 × 5 × 89 × 401
(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 89 × 401)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 12848040 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 12848040
Divisors of 12848040
- Number of divisors d(n): 96
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 5 6 8 9 10 12 15 18 20 24 30 36 40 45 60 72 89 90 120 178 180 267 356 360 401 445 534 712 801 802 890 1068 1203 1335 1602 1604 1780 2005 2136 2406 2670 3204 3208 3560 3609 4005 4010 4812 5340 6015 6408 7218 8010 8020 9624 10680 12030 14436 16020 16040 18045 24060 28872 32040 35689 36090 48120 71378 72180 107067 142756 144360 178445 214134 285512 321201 356890 428268 535335 642402 713780 856536 1070670 1284804 1427560 1606005 2141340 2569608 3212010 4282680 6424020 12848040
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 42330600
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 29482560
- 12848040 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(29482560)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 16634520
